การจดจำแท็กปิดตัวเองโดยโปรแกรมใน Excel

การแนะนำ

การทำความเข้าใจแท็กปิดตัวเองใน Excel อาจฟังดูเป็นเรื่องเฉพาะ แต่ด้วยเครื่องมืออย่าง Aspose.Cells สำหรับ .NET ทำให้การจัดการและปรับเปลี่ยนข้อมูล HTML ง่ายกว่าที่เคย ในคู่มือนี้ เราจะอธิบายกระบวนการทีละขั้นตอน เพื่อให้คุณรู้สึกได้รับการสนับสนุนและรับทราบข้อมูลในทุกขั้นตอน ไม่ว่าคุณจะเป็นนักพัฒนาที่มีประสบการณ์หรือเพิ่งเริ่มต้นใช้งานระบบอัตโนมัติของ Excel ฉันพร้อมช่วยเหลือคุณเสมอ!

ข้อกำหนดเบื้องต้น

ก่อนที่เราจะออกเดินทาง คุณจะต้องตรวจสอบรายการบางรายการจากรายการของคุณเพื่อให้แน่ใจว่าทุกอย่างดำเนินไปอย่างราบรื่น:

  1. Visual Studio: ตรวจสอบให้แน่ใจว่าคุณได้ติดตั้ง Visual Studio ไว้ในเครื่องของคุณแล้ว ซึ่งถือเป็นสิ่งสำคัญสำหรับการเขียนและดำเนินการแอปพลิเคชัน .NET
  2. .NET Framework: ตรวจสอบให้แน่ใจว่าคุณได้ติดตั้ง .NET Framework แล้ว Aspose.Cells ทำงานร่วมกับ .NET Framework ได้อย่างดี จึงถือเป็นหัวใจสำคัญ
  3. Aspose.Cells สำหรับ .NET: คุณจะต้องมีไลบรารี Aspose.Cells คุณสามารถ ดาวน์โหลดได้ที่นี่ .
  4. ไฟล์ตัวอย่าง HTML: เตรียมไฟล์ตัวอย่าง HTML ให้พร้อมสำหรับการทดสอบ (เราจะสร้างและใช้sampleSelfClosingTags.html ในตัวอย่างของเรา)
  5. ความรู้พื้นฐานด้านการเขียนโปรแกรม: ความรู้ C# เพียงเล็กน้อยก็มีประโยชน์มาก คุณควรจะเขียนและรันสคริปต์ง่ายๆ ได้อย่างคล่องแคล่ว เมื่อมีข้อกำหนดเบื้องต้นเหล่านี้แล้ว คุณก็พร้อมที่จะเริ่มเขียนโค้ดได้เลย!

แพ็คเกจนำเข้า

ก่อนที่เราจะไปถึงส่วนที่สนุก เรามาตรวจสอบให้แน่ใจก่อนว่าเรากำลังนำเข้าแพ็คเกจที่ถูกต้อง ทำสิ่งนี้ภายในไฟล์ C# ของคุณ:

using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;

แพ็คเกจเหล่านี้ช่วยให้คุณเข้าถึงฟีเจอร์ของ Aspose.Cells ที่คุณจะใช้ในการใช้งานของคุณ พร้อมหรือยัง มาแบ่งกระบวนการออกเป็นขั้นตอนที่จัดการได้กันเถอะ!

ขั้นตอนที่ 1: ตั้งค่าไดเร็กทอรีของคุณ

ทุกโครงการต้องมีการจัดระเบียบ และโครงการนี้ก็ไม่ต่างกัน มาตั้งค่าไดเร็กทอรีที่จะเก็บไฟล์ HTML ต้นฉบับและไฟล์ Excel เอาต์พุตของคุณกันเถอะ

// ไดเรกทอรีอินพุต
string sourceDir = "Your Document Directory";
// ไดเรกทอรีผลลัพธ์
string outputDir = "Your Document Directory";

ที่นี่คุณกำหนดตัวแปรสำหรับไดเร็กทอรีแหล่งที่มาและเอาต์พุต แทนที่"Your Document Directory" ด้วยเส้นทางไฟล์จริงของคุณ ขั้นตอนนี้มีความจำเป็นเพื่อให้ไฟล์ของคุณเป็นระเบียบ!

ขั้นตอนที่ 2: เริ่มต้นตัวเลือกการโหลด HTML

มาบอกให้ Aspose ทราบว่าเราต้องการจัดการ HTML อย่างไร ขั้นตอนนี้จะตั้งค่าตัวเลือกสำคัญบางอย่างเมื่อโหลดไฟล์ของคุณ

// ตั้งค่าตัวเลือกการโหลด HTML และรักษาความแม่นยำให้เป็นจริง
HtmlLoadOptions loadOptions = new HtmlLoadOptions(LoadFormat.Html);

เรากำลังสร้างอินสแตนซ์ใหม่ของHtmlLoadOptionsโดยระบุรูปแบบการโหลดเป็น HTML การตั้งค่านี้จะช่วยรักษารายละเอียดและโครงสร้างของไฟล์ HTML ของคุณเมื่อนำเข้าไปยัง Excel

ขั้นตอนที่ 3: โหลดไฟล์ตัวอย่าง HTML

ตอนนี้มาถึงส่วนที่น่าตื่นเต้น: การโหลด HTML ของคุณลงในเวิร์กบุ๊ก นี่คือจุดที่ความมหัศจรรย์เกิดขึ้น!

// โหลดไฟล์ตัวอย่างต้นฉบับ
Workbook wb = new Workbook(sourceDir + "sampleSelfClosingTags.html", loadOptions);

เรากำลังสร้างใหม่Workbook อินสแตนซ์และการโหลดในไฟล์ HTML หากไฟล์ของคุณมีโครงสร้างที่ดี Aspose จะแปลความหมายได้อย่างสวยงามเมื่อแสดงผลใน Excel

ขั้นตอนที่ 4: บันทึกสมุดงาน

เมื่อเราจัดวางข้อมูลไว้อย่างสวยงามในเวิร์กบุ๊กแล้ว ก็ถึงเวลาที่จะบันทึกข้อมูลนั้น

// บันทึกสมุดงาน
wb.Save(outputDir + "outsampleSelfClosingTags.xlsx");

คำสั่งนี้แจ้งให้ Aspose บันทึกเวิร์กบุ๊กของเราเป็น.xlsx ไฟล์ในไดเร็กทอรีเอาต์พุตที่ระบุ เลือกชื่อที่สะท้อนถึงเนื้อหา เช่นoutsampleSelfClosingTags.xlsx.

ขั้นตอนที่ 5: การยืนยันการดำเนินการ

สุดท้ายนี้ เรามาเพิ่มเอาต์พุตคอนโซลแบบง่ายๆ เพื่อยืนยันกันดีกว่า เป็นเรื่องดีเสมอที่รู้ว่าทุกอย่างเป็นไปตามแผน!

Console.WriteLine("RecognizeSelfClosingTags executed successfully.\r\n");

บรรทัดนี้จะส่งข้อความไปยังคอนโซลเพื่อยืนยันว่าการดำเนินการเสร็จสมบูรณ์ ง่ายแต่มีประสิทธิภาพ!

บทสรุป

ตอนนี้คุณมีความรู้ที่จำเป็นในการจดจำแท็กที่ปิดตัวเองด้วยโปรแกรมใน Excel โดยใช้ Aspose.Cells สำหรับ .NET แล้ว ซึ่งจะช่วยเปิดโลกแห่งความเป็นไปได้สำหรับโปรเจ็กต์ที่เกี่ยวข้องกับเนื้อหา HTML และการจัดรูปแบบ Excel ไม่ว่าคุณจะจัดการการส่งออกข้อมูลหรือแปลงเนื้อหาเว็บเพื่อการวิเคราะห์ คุณก็พร้อมแล้วที่จะใช้เครื่องมืออันทรงพลัง

คำถามที่พบบ่อย

แท็กปิดตัวเองคืออะไร

แท็กปิดตัวเองคือแท็ก HTML ที่ไม่จำเป็นต้องมีแท็กปิดแยกต่างหาก เช่น<img /> หรือ<br />.

ฉันสามารถดาวน์โหลด Aspose.Cells ได้ฟรีหรือไม่?

ใช่คุณสามารถใช้ เวอร์ชันทดลองใช้ฟรีที่นี่ .

ฉันจะได้รับการสนับสนุนสำหรับ Aspose.Cells ได้จากที่ไหน

หากต้องการความช่วยเหลือ โปรดไปที่ ฟอรั่ม Aspose .

Aspose.Cells เข้ากันได้กับ .NET Core ได้หรือไม่

ใช่ Aspose.Cells มีความเข้ากันได้กับ .NET หลายเวอร์ชัน รวมถึง .NET Core

ฉันสามารถซื้อใบอนุญาตสำหรับ Aspose.Cells ได้อย่างไร?

คุณสามารถทำได้ ซื้อใบอนุญาตที่นี่ .